Shengavit
Shengavit, is a Yerevan Metro station opened on February 15, 1986. The station has a two-way route to Garegin Nzhdeh Square station in one direction and Charbakh station in the other direction.Photo: GeoO, CC BY-SA 4.0.

Garegin Nzhdeh Square
Metro station
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Garegin Nzhdeh Square is a Yerevan Metro station, opened on December 31, 1986. It is located in the Shengavit District and has exits to Garegin Nzhdeh Square, Garegin Nzhdeh Street, and Bagratunyats Avenue. Garegin Nzhdeh Square is situated 690 metres north of Shengavit.
Alashkert Stadium
Stadium
Photo: Spetsnaz 1991, CC BY 2.0.
Nairi Stadium is a football stadium in Yerevan, Armenia. It was known as Alashkert Stadium between 2013 and 2024, being home to the local football club FC Alashkert. Alashkert Stadium is situated 1¼ km northwest of Shengavit.
Yerevan Mall
Shopping center
Photo: Armineaghayan,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Yerevan Mall is a shopping mall located on Arshakunyats Avenue, Yerevan, Armenia. Opened in 2014, it is the second largest mall in Armenia in terms of number of stores and total floor area. Yerevan Mall is situated 1½ km northeast of Shengavit.

Shengavit District
Suburb
Photo: H-dayan,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Shengavit, is one of the 12 districts of Yerevan, the capital of Armenia, located at the southwestern part of the city. It has common borders with the districts of Malatia-Sebastia, Kentron, Erebuni and Nubarashen. Ararat Province forms the southern borders of the district.
